Definition

Pyrite is a common noun referring to a mineral also known as "fool's gold," characterized by its metallic luster and pale brass-yellow hue. It is composed of iron sulfide (FeS2) and is often found in sedimentary, metamorphic, and igneous rocks. Pyrite is commonly associated with other minerals and can be an indicator of the presence of gold.
